Subject: [PATCH v4 10/41] hwmon: add HAS_IOPORT dependencies
Date: Tue, 16 May 2023 13:00:06 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230516110038.2413224-11-schnelle@linux.ibm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230516110038.2413224-1-schnelle@linux.ibm.com>

In a future patch HAS_IOPORT=n will result in inb()/outb() and friends
not being declared. We thus need to add HAS_IOPORT as dependency for
those drivers using them.

Note: The HAS_IOPORT Kconfig option was added in v6.4-rc1 so
      per-subsystem patches may be applied independently
